深度探索DeepSeek:解锁AI开发新范式的核心路径与实践指南
2025.09.25 15:39浏览量:0简介:本文深度解析DeepSeek技术框架,从架构设计到工程实践,系统阐述其在AI开发中的核心价值,提供可落地的技术方案与优化策略,助力开发者突破效率瓶颈。
深度探索DeepSeek:解锁AI开发新范式的核心路径与实践指南
一、DeepSeek技术定位与核心价值
在AI开发领域,DeepSeek以”深度搜索”为核心能力,构建了覆盖数据预处理、模型训练、推理优化的全链路解决方案。其技术定位聚焦于解决传统AI开发中的三大痛点:数据孤岛导致的特征缺失、模型训练效率低下、推理延迟过高。通过动态特征融合算法,DeepSeek可将分散在不同数据源的特征进行实时关联,例如在电商推荐场景中,将用户行为数据(点击、浏览时长)与商品属性数据(价格、品类)进行深度耦合,使特征维度从传统方案的50-100维提升至300-500维,模型AUC指标提升12%-18%。
在工程实践层面,DeepSeek采用分层架构设计,底层依赖分布式计算框架(如Ray或Horovod)实现参数服务器的并行更新,中层通过特征工程管道(Feature Pipeline)完成数据清洗、特征派生等操作,上层封装了模型训练接口(支持PyTorch/TensorFlow)和推理服务(gRPC/RESTful API)。这种设计使单节点训练速度较原生框架提升2.3倍,100节点集群下的模型收敛时间从72小时缩短至18小时。
二、DeepSeek技术架构深度解析
1. 动态特征融合引擎
该引擎采用图神经网络(GNN)架构,将不同数据源的特征建模为异构图中的节点,通过注意力机制计算节点间权重。例如在金融风控场景中,用户基本信息(年龄、职业)作为静态节点,交易记录(金额、频率)作为动态节点,设备指纹(IP、IMEI)作为环境节点,引擎可自动学习三者间的关联强度。实测数据显示,该方案使欺诈交易识别准确率从89%提升至94%,误报率降低37%。
2. 分布式训练优化器
针对大规模模型训练,DeepSeek实现了参数服务器与AllReduce的混合通信模式。在参数更新阶段,稀疏参数(如Embedding层)通过参数服务器异步更新,密集参数(如全连接层)采用Ring AllReduce同步更新。这种设计使10亿参数模型的通信开销从45%降至18%,在NVIDIA A100集群上实现92%的GPU利用率。
3. 推理服务动态批处理
通过动态批处理算法,DeepSeek可根据请求负载实时调整批处理大小。当QPS<100时,采用最小批处理(batch_size=4)降低延迟;当QPS>500时,自动切换至最大批处理(batch_size=128)提升吞吐量。测试表明,该策略使推理延迟的标准差从12ms降至3ms,99分位延迟降低41%。
三、工程实践中的关键优化策略
1. 特征工程管道优化
- 数据分区策略:按时间戳将数据划分为训练集(80%)、验证集(10%)、测试集(10%),避免未来信息泄露。例如在时序预测任务中,使用过去30天的数据训练,未来7天的数据验证。
- 特征派生规则:定义数值型特征(如金额取对数)、类别型特征(如One-Hot编码)、时序型特征(如滑动窗口统计)的派生逻辑。示例代码:
def derive_features(df):# 数值型特征处理df['log_amount'] = np.log(df['amount'] + 1)# 类别型特征编码df = pd.get_dummies(df, columns=['category'])# 时序型特征计算df['rolling_avg'] = df.groupby('user_id')['amount'].transform(lambda x: x.rolling(7).mean())return df
2. 模型训练超参调优
- 学习率调度:采用余弦退火策略,初始学习率设为0.01,每10个epoch衰减至0.001。示例配置:
scheduler = torch.optim.lr_scheduler.CosineAnnealingLR(optimizer, T_max=100, eta_min=0.001)
- 正则化策略:结合L2正则化(系数0.01)和Dropout(概率0.3)防止过拟合。在PyTorch中的实现:
model = nn.Sequential(nn.Linear(100, 50),nn.Dropout(0.3),nn.ReLU(),nn.Linear(50, 10))criterion = nn.CrossEntropyLoss() + 0.01 * nn.MSELoss() # L2正则化
3. 推理服务部署方案
- 容器化部署:使用Docker封装推理服务,配置资源限制(CPU 2核、内存4GB、GPU 1块)。Dockerfile示例:
FROM pytorch/pytorch:1.9.0-cuda11.1-cudnn8-runtimeCOPY model.pth /app/COPY inference.py /app/WORKDIR /appCMD ["python", "inference.py"]
- 自动扩缩容策略:基于Kubernetes的HPA(Horizontal Pod Autoscaler),设置CPU利用率阈值为70%,当负载超过时自动增加Pod数量。配置示例:
apiVersion: autoscaling/v2kind: HorizontalPodAutoscalermetadata:name: deepseek-hpaspec:scaleTargetRef:apiVersion: apps/v1kind: Deploymentname: deepseek-deploymentminReplicas: 2maxReplicas: 10metrics:- type: Resourceresource:name: cputarget:type: UtilizationaverageUtilization: 70
四、行业应用案例与效果验证
1. 电商推荐系统优化
某头部电商平台接入DeepSeek后,推荐系统的点击率(CTR)提升21%,转化率(CVR)提升15%。关键改进点包括:
- 用户画像维度从200+扩展至800+,新增”夜间活跃度””价格敏感度”等特征
- 实时特征更新频率从小时级提升至分钟级
- 模型推理延迟从120ms降至45ms
2. 金融风控模型升级
某银行信用卡反欺诈系统采用DeepSeek后,欺诈交易识别准确率达98.7%,误报率降至0.3%。技术突破体现在:
- 构建包含用户行为、设备信息、商户特征的异构图
- 实现特征实时计算与模型在线学习
- 部署多模型集成策略(XGBoost+DeepFM)
3. 智能制造缺陷检测
某汽车零部件厂商通过DeepSeek的时序特征分析能力,将产品缺陷检测准确率从92%提升至97%。具体实现:
- 采集生产线传感器数据(振动、温度、压力)
- 构建LSTM时序模型预测设备故障
- 结合计算机视觉进行缺陷定位
五、开发者实践建议与未来展望
对于开发者而言,建议从以下三个维度切入DeepSeek的应用:
- 数据治理层:优先构建统一特征存储(Feature Store),实现特征复用与版本管理
- 模型开发层:采用AutoML工具进行超参自动调优,减少人工试错成本
- 服务部署层:实施灰度发布策略,通过A/B测试验证模型效果
未来,DeepSeek将向三个方向演进:
- 多模态融合:支持文本、图像、语音的跨模态特征关联
- 边缘计算优化:开发轻量化推理引擎,适配移动端设备
- 因果推理增强:引入反事实推理模块,提升模型可解释性
通过系统掌握DeepSeek的技术架构与实践方法,开发者可显著提升AI项目的开发效率与业务价值,在数据驱动的决策时代占据先机。

发表评论
登录后可评论,请前往 登录 或 注册